1) World-Class Universities
Universities in Canada are ranked amongst the top universities in the world. As per the QS World University Rankings 2025, 8 Canadian universities are ranked in the top 200 categories. In addition, Times World University Rankings 2025 has ranked 7 Canadian universities within the 200 ranks.
Predict your IELTS, TOEFL, and PTE in just 4 steps!
The rankings are based on various factors such as research reputation, the learning and teaching environment, research impact, etc. These rankings reflect the fact that Canadian universities have performed well on various metrics. Moreover, it is not only the quality of education that these universities provide but also the quality of life that the students can enjoy. Canadian universities have excellent infrastructure, accommodation facilities, sports and recreation facilities, research facilities, and much more. They offer the students an opportunity to excel on the academic front and grow on the personal front.

3) Affordable Education
Canada is definitely more affordable than other developed countries such as the US and the UK. However, students must note that the cost of studying in Canada depends on a variety of factors such as their location, accommodation, dietary choices, lifestyle, travel, etc. The average of all the data available shows that the average cost of an undergraduate program is nearly C$26,442, and the average cost of a graduate program is C$18,159. 4) Easier Post Graduate Work Permit Rules
Post Graduate Work Permit Canada (PGWP Canada) rules allow a student to stay back in Canada and work over there. The terms and conditions for pursuing post-study work in Canada are much more relaxed as compared to other countries such as the US. These rules finally lead to a Canada PR (Permanent Resident). However, in order to be eligible for a PGWP Canada, the duration of the academic course must be at least 8 months. If the duration is more than 8 months but less than 2 years, you will get a work permit for a period equal to your course duration. If the duration of the course is 2 years or more, you may receive a work permit of 3 years.

Q: What IELTS score is required for UCW Canada?
Yes, the minimum English proficiency requirements for admission in the University of Canada West are:
TEST | MINIMUM OVERALL SCORE | MINIMUM WRITING SCORE |
---|---|---|
IELTS – Academic | 6.5 | 6.0 |
IELTS – Indicator | 6.5 | 6.0 |
CAEL | 70 | 60* |
CAEL Online | 70 | 60* |
CAE* | 176 | N/A |
Duolingo* | 110 | 100* |
Password | 6.5 | 6.0 |
PTE – Academic | 61 | 60 |
TOEFL – iBT | 88 | 20* |
*The minimum writing score is also applicable to all assessed components of the test.
*May be either of the following three tests; Cambridge B2 First; Cambridge C1 Advanced; or Cambridge C2 Proficiency
*After July 31, 2023, UCW will only accept Duolingo from applicants from Ukraine, Russia, Iran and Belarus. However, UCW may accept Duolingo from applicants in other countries where no other English proficiency test is available. If an applicant is submitting a Duolingo test score from any country other than Ukraine, Russia, Iran or Belarus, they must send it along with an explanation letter, but acceptance is not guaranteed. All other applications with a Duolingo result submitted after July 31, 2023 will be returned.
*Writing is assessed as the average score for achievement in both Literacy and Production.

Q: Is Canada or USA cheaper to study?
International students are more likely to receive financial help or scholarships from Canadian universities than from American ones, which is quite uncommon. Furthermore, tuition at Canadian institutions is typically 27% less expensive than that of US universities. However, some United States universities offer international students Financial aid and other scholarships that help them to study in the United States.
Q: How do I get admission in Humber College, Canada?
Humber College Canada requires international students to apply through the international college portal and view the programme and term in take availability as the admissions are offered based on programme space availability. Every programme has its own requirements and eligibility criteria. International students are also required to submit English Language tests such as IELTS, TOEFL, PTE, or Duolingo. Humber College application deadline is Feb 01,2025 for equal consideration. Post this date, admissions are offered on the space basis available. Therefore, students are required to apply as early as possible.

Q: How many intakes are there in Saskatchewan of Polytechnic?
Applicants aspiring to get admissions into the Saskatchewan Polytechnic are required to submit their applications before the set deadline of that particular year. Following are the general admission deadlines, however, applicants should check the official website for program-specific application dates.
Entry Term | Deadlines |
---|---|
January Intake | Oct 1, 2024 |
September Intake | May 1, 2024 |
Note: For international applicants with student visas, the application period closes on December 31.
